Innovative Strategies in Robot Technology

Robotics has emerged as a vital area of development, providing answers to some of the most critical worldwide problems. One remarkable application is in disaster response, where robots are designed to traverse dangerous environments, identify survivors, and deliver essential goods. Equipped with sophisticated sensors and AI, these robots can function in conditions too unsafe for human responders, showcasing their capability to save lives and hasten recovery efforts in crisis situations.

Another significant advancement in robotics is in agriculture, where mechanization is changing historic agricultural practices. Advanced agriculture techniques utilize robots to assess crop health, enhance irrigation, and execute harvesting tasks. These advancements not only increase efficiency but also reduce the environmental footprint of farming by decreasing surplus and resource use. By leveraging robotics, farmers are able to produce food more responsibly and meet the growing global need. https://congresovoluntariadocanarias.org/

Robotics is also making a significant impact on medical care, with advancements such as automated surgery and patient care aiding devices. Surgical robots allow for less invasive procedures, leading to shorter recovery times and less injury for patients. Additionally, robots developed to assist the older adults and handicapped can improve quality of life by providing company and assistance with everyday activities. These developments illustrate the diverse applications of robotics in boosting human wellbeing and addressing critical societal needs.

The role of software in Social Impact

Technology has emerged as a vital means for combating community problems globally. From health care to the field of education, cutting-edge software solutions are assisting organizations enhance their operations and outreach. For instance, telemedicine platforms enable remote consultations, providing medical access to disadvantaged populations. In education, learning management systems promote online courses that cater to varied learning needs, breaking geographical barriers and enhancing access to knowledge.

Moreover, data-driven software applications are revolutionizing how charities and non-profits operate. By utilizing analytics, organizations can assess the impact of their programs and streamline resource allocation. This data transparency builds trust and accountability among stakeholders and enhances overall effectiveness. Social enterprises are also using software to connect with communities directly, allowing them to satisfy local needs more efficiently and customize their efforts appropriately.

Furthermore, mobile applications have established themselves as a crucial means of communication for social change. Users can report issues, access essential information, or connect with local services promptly. These platforms enable citizens to advocate for their rights and access assistance in urgent circumstances. Thus, software is not only facilitating innovative solutions but also instilling community engagement and resilience in confronting social challenges.

Examples of Technology for Good

One striking case of tech making a substantial impact is the use of robotics in emergency relief efforts. State-of-the-art robotic systems have been deployed in areas affected by catastrophes, such as earthquakes and flooding. These robots can carry out search and rescue operations, navigate through rubble, and even bring supplies to people trapped in inaccessible locations. By enhancing the capabilities of first responders, these robotic solutions protect lives and accelerate recovery times, showcasing how innovation can address urgent global challenges.

In the realm of digital solutions, platforms like this notable platform illustrate the potential of tech to support social change. Originally developed to track reports of abuse in the region, Ushahidi has evolved into a flexible tool for crowdsourcing information during crises. It enables users to submit issues such as floods, health outbreaks, or abuses, which can be displayed on dynamic maps. This platform empowers groups and organizations to respond quickly and effectively to local challenges, highlighting how digital innovation fosters transparency and accountability.

Another significant innovation comes from the realm of clean energy solutions. Companies are utilizing advancements in energy management software to enhance the use of solar and wind power. These technologies allow users to manage energy usage efficiently and reduce loss, contributing to more sustainable energy practices. By broadening access to energy resources and promoting eco-friendly solutions, these innovations provide a powerful tool in the fight against climate change while also fostering economic development in underserved regions.
